A SpaceX Falcon 9 rocket launched the NROL-146 mission for the National Reconnaissance Office (NRO) from California's Vandenberg Space Force Base at on May 22, 2024 at 4 a.m. EDT (0800 GMT; 1 a.m. local California time). Full Story: www.space.com/spacex-nro-spy-...
According to Space.com, the first stage touched down on the drone ship Of Course I still Love You stationed in the Pacific Ocean around nine minutes after launch.
